From 21 September to 26 January, the Paderborn Diocesan Museum is hosting a special exhibition entitled ‘Corvey and the Legacy of Antiquity: Emperors, Monasteries and Cultural Transfer in the Middle Ages’. 120 artefacts on loan can be admired. Dr Christiane Ruhmann has been the curator of the Diocesan Museum's special exhibitions for many years.

On 20 September, Prof. Dr Harald Wolter-von dem Knesebeck (Bonn), head of the art history section of the Görres Society, will give the opening lecture. The former Abbey Corvey, located near Paderborn, was founded 1200 years ago and has been a UNESCO World Heritage Site for 10 years.
